LONDON plays host to its first ever Bellator event at the SSE Arena on May 19.

Canadian UFC veteran Rory MacDonald will go up against the notorious Paul Daley in what will be the pick of the fights.

Paul Daley vs Rory MacDonald

The headline fight of the night features Brit Paul Daley taking on UFC veteran Rory MacDonald.

It will be MacDonald’s first taste of a Bellator event after he decided to call time on his UFC career following a defeat to Stephen Thomson.

MacDonald has stated serious intentions to with both the welterweight and middleweight championships.

His opponent Daley has also had a taste in UFC but was banned after he lashed out at an opponent after the bell went.

It will be his seventh Bellator event, winning five and losing one so far.

Who else is fighting at Bellator 179?

 

Michael Page was set to fight Derek Anderson in the co-headline bout, but the heavyweight match-up was cancelled after  Page suffered a knee injury.

Cheick Kongo and Augusto Sakai will do battle in a heavyweight clash on the card.

A light heavyweight bout between friends Liam McGeary and Linton Vassell is also on offer.

Full match card

Rory MacDonald vs Paul Daley (Welterweight)

Liam McGeary vs Linton Vassell (Light-heavyweight)

Cheick Kongo vs Augusto Sakai (Heavyweight)

Dan Edwards vs Alex Lohore (Welterweight)

Kevin Ferguson Jr vs DJ Griffin (Welterweight)
